    #include<bits/stdc++.h>
    #define overload(a,b,c,d,...) d
    #define rep1(a) for(ll _=0;_<(ll)a;++_)
    #define rep2(i,a) for(ll i=0;i<(ll)a;++i)
    #define rep3(i,a,b) for(ll i=a;i<(ll)b;++i)
    #define rep(...) overload(__VA_ARGS__,rep3,rep2,rep1)(__VA_ARGS__)
    #define rrep1(i,a) for(ll i=(ll)a-1;i>=0;--i)
    #define rrep2(i,a,b) for(ll i=(ll)b-1;i>=(ll)a;--i)
    #define rrep(...) overload(__VA_ARGS__,rrep2,rrep1)(__VA_ARGS__)
    #define all(a) a.begin(),a.end()
    #define lb(v,x) lower_bound(all(v),x);
    #define ub(v,x) upper_bound(all(v),x);
    using namespace std;
    using ll=long long;
    using ull=unsigned long long;
    using ld=long double;
    template<typename T,typename U>
    inline bool chmin(T&a,const U&b){return (a>b?a=b,true:false);}
    template<typename T,typename U>
    inline bool chmax(T&a,const U&b){return (a<b?a=b,true:false);}
    struct dsu{
        private:
        vector<int>p;
        vector<pair<int,int>>history;
        public:
        dsu(int n):p(n,-1){}
        int root(int x){return (p[x]<0?x:root(p[x]));}
        int size(int a){return -p[root(a)];}
        void merge(int u,int v){
            u=root(u),v=root(v);
            if(u==v)return ;
            if(p[u]>p[v])swap(u,v);
            history.emplace_back(v,p[v]);
            p[u]+=p[v];
            p[v]=u;
        }
        void snapshot(){history.clear();}
        void rollback(){
            while(history.size()){
                auto [u,sz]=history.back();history.pop_back();
                p[p[u]]-=sz;
                p[u]=sz;
            }
        }
    };
    struct edge{
        int u,v,w;
    };
    struct query{
        int t,x,w,idx;
    };
    int main(){
        ios::sync_with_stdio(false);
        cin.tie(nullptr);
        int n,m;cin>>n>>m;
        vector<edge>es(m);
        rep(i,m){
            int u,v,w;cin>>u>>v>>w;u--,v--;
            es[i]=edge{u,v,w};
        }
        int q;cin>>q;
        vector<query>qs(q);
        vector<int>ans(q);
        rep(i,q){
            cin>>qs[i].t>>qs[i].x>>qs[i].w;
            qs[i].idx=i;
            qs[i].x--;
        }
        constexpr int B=334;
        for(int l=0;l<q;l+=B){
            const int r=min(q,l+B);
            const int sz=r-l;
            vector<bool>changed(m,false);
            vector<query>qu;
            rep(i,l,r){
                if(qs[i].t==1)changed[qs[i].x]=1;
                else qu.emplace_back(qs[i]);
            }
            vector<edge>pre;
            vector<int>chg;
            rep(i,m){
                //cerr<<changed[i]<<" ";
                if(changed[i])chg.push_back(i);
                else pre.push_back(es[i]);
            }//cerr<<endl;
            sort(all(pre),[](const auto&l,const auto&r){
                return l.w<r.w;
            });
            sort(all(qu),[](const auto&l,const auto&r){
                return l.w>r.w;
            });
            vector<vector<int>>merge(sz);
            rep(i,l,r){
                if(qs[i].t==1)es[qs[i].x].w=qs[i].w;
                else for(auto j:chg)if(es[j].w>=qs[i].w)merge[i-l].emplace_back(j);
            }
            dsu d(n);
            for(auto [t,x,w,idx]:qu){
                //cerr<<t<<" "<<x<<" "<<w<<" "<<idx<<endl;
                while(!pre.empty()&&pre.back().w>=w){
                    //cerr<<pre.back().u<<" "<<pre.back().v<<" "<<pre.back().w<<endl;
                    d.merge(pre.back().u,pre.back().v);
                    pre.pop_back();
                }
                d.snapshot();
                //cerr<<1<<endl;
                for(auto j:merge[idx-l]){
                    //cerr<<es[j].u<<" "<<es[j].v<<endl;
                    d.merge(es[j].u,es[j].v);
                }
                ans[idx]=d.size(x);
                d.rollback();
            }
        }
        rep(i,q)if(qs[i].t==2)cout<<ans[i]<<"\n";
    }
